DUSHANBE, February 12, 2010, Asia-Plus  — Three foreigners were detained at the Dushanbe airport on February 11 and totaling more than 5 kilograms of heroin were confiscated from them, according to the Customs Service under the Government of Tajikistan.

An inspection of passengers on the flight Dushanbe-Bishkek (Kyrgyzstan) found 1.606 kilograms of heroin hidden in luggage of Russian national Igor Shestakov and 1.795 kilograms and 1.604 kilograms of heroin hidden in luggage of two women from Lithuania – 24-year-old Cristina Bizyulyavichyute and 45-year-old Dalya Deksnene – respectively.

Criminal proceedings have been instituted against the detained drug couriers and an investigation is under way.
